To check the current hostname of your Ubuntu system, use one of two available commands. 1. The hostnamecommand displays only the hostname itself. 1. The other command, hostnamectl, displays additional information about your computer system. The Static hostnameline displays your machine’s hostname. How do I change the hostname without a restart? - Ask Ubuntu

WebHere is the command line way: Open a terminal Ctrl + Alt + T and enter sudo hostname newname. Replace newname of your device by the new name that you want to call your device. Enter your password. Then, edit the oldname in /etc/hostname. sudo nano /etc/hostname. and change the old name. Do the same in /etc/hosts. sudo nano /etc/hosts.
